Ribbed Bog Moss (Glow Moss)

Aulacomnium palustre - Plants medium-sized, unbranched to occasionally branched, stems upright, 3-9 cm high, with abundant, reddish covering of hairs, often tipped by a short, leafless stalk that has small, lance-shaped gemmae along its entire length (although there may be more towards the tip). Found on organic soils and occasionally on rotten logs; most common on disturbed, peaty banks in peatlands, where it occurs on acid peat in bogs and on acidic micro-habitats in rich fens; also on organic soils in tundra and subalpine habitats.
